Located on the northern shores of Lake Macquarie NSW, Biddabah Public School is proud to be a public primary school with an enrolment of 395 students. Biddabah enjoys a high reputation in its local community.

Message From The Principal
Welcome to the Biddabah Public School website. I hope that this will be of value as a ready reference and a source of information about the school and its policies.
At Biddabah, the goal we are all working towards (staff, parents and students) is to make our good school better. The belief that every child can learn justifies the way we go about things at this school. Continually seeking the right mix of traditional and contemporary values assures that we are always looking to do the best we can. Consequently the contents of this site will be subject to amendment as our ideas and outlooks respond to our changing environment.
I invite you to take an active interest in your child and school by attending P&C meetings and by taking an interest in and supporting the functioning of the School Council. P&C meets at 7.30pm on the third Wednesday of each month and School Council meets eight times a year. Dates will be notified in the Parent Newsletter.
The Parent Newsletter comes out each Thursday and is placed on the website the following Friday. The goal is to inform you about things that are happening in day to day operations as well as the long term directions that influence the way the school operates.
Although much time is invested in communication between school and home, there will always be times that the message from classroom or school becomes confused or some other problem arises. If you have a concern I would encourage you to contact either myself or the appropriate member of staff as soon as possible and we will do everything we can to resolve the issue. In the first instance however I would request that you assume good will on the school's part and believe that we will do everything in our power to make Biddabah a happy and safe schooling experience for your child.
I look forward to a happy association with you and your children.
